Drug Detox Withdrawal Symptoms

Research on drug withdrawal shows that when you abruptly stop using different drugs and/or alcohol, you might encounter various symptoms; these symptoms - as well as their severity - will vary from one client to the other.

Some things that could potentially influence your experience during withdrawal as you undergo detoxification include:

How long you were addicted; using drugs on a daily basis for a long time could cause you to develop tolerance, which means that your withdrawal might be more severe.

The types of substances you abused; in many situations, you may find that those addicted to more than one substance might experience unique withdrawal with a constellation of unusual symptoms because one substance could intensify the other's symptoms.

The amount of drugs or alcohol you were abusing when you enrolled in the detox program in Bliss, New York. Many people experience tolerance after abusing drugs for a long time; basically, they might have to up the amount of drugs and/or alcohol the use to get the effect that they want. However, such high doses may eventually cause intense and severe withdrawal when you decide to stop using.

The existence of any co-occurring mental and physical health disorders; people with mental health issues like depression and anxiety or physical issues such as insomnia and chronic pain might have more severe distress and withdrawal symptoms.

The half-life of the intoxicating substances; drugs with a short half life cause more immediate withdrawal symptoms whereas substances that are longer acting might cause your withdrawal symptoms to be delayed for several hours or days.

Recent studies on addiction rehab show that when you go through detoxification, you may develop any of the following withdrawal symptoms:

  • Agitation
  • Chills
  • Cravings
  • Flu-like symptoms, which could include vomiting, nausea, headache, and runny nose
  • Irritability
  • Mood swings
  • Shaking
  • Sleep disturbances and insomnia
  • Sweating
  • Tremors
